3 definitions

obligated (Verb) — Force somebody to do something.

obligated (Verb) — Commit in order to fulfil an obligation. ex. "obligate money"

obligated (Verb) — Bind by an obligation; cause to be indebted. ex. "He's obligated by a contract"

1 definition

obligated (Adjective) — Caused by law or conscience to follow a certain course. ex. "felt obligated to repay the kindness" ex. "was obligated to pay off the student loan"
